When i start explorer there is an bar at top that says that add-ons are
disabled. I went thru all the settings in control panel and reset everything
and i still cant get them to work. It will show an blank page on screen
untill i click on home then it will go to the home page. Can anyone help?

> When i start explorer there is an bar at top that says that add-ons are
> disabled.

That implies that you are starting from a shortcut which has been modified
to add the  -extoff  switch to it  (aka  No Add-ons mode.)

> I went thru all the settings in control panel and reset everything
> and i still cant get them to work. It will show an blank page on screen
> untill i click on home then it will go to the home page. Can anyone help?

Sounds like you also have modified it to add  -nohome  to the command-line.

Perhaps you are using diagnostics without understanding why they were
suggested?
